Tracheal incision as a contributing factor to tracheal stenosis. An experimental study
The Annals of Otology, Rhinology, and Laryngology
|November 1, 1975
Summary
Flap tracheostomies preserve tracheal lumen area better than vertical incisions, reducing distortion and promoting cartilage regrowth. This animal study supports flap techniques for improved outcomes in tracheostomy procedures.

Background:
- Tracheostomy is a common surgical procedure.
- Vertical incisions can lead to tracheal lumen distortion.
- Alternative flap techniques may offer improved outcomes.
Purpose of the Study:
- To compare the efficacy of flap versus vertical tracheostomy incisions.
- To evaluate the impact of different tracheostomy techniques on tracheal lumen preservation.
- To assess histological changes and cartilage regeneration post-tracheostomy.
Main Methods:
- 25 mongrel dogs underwent tracheostomy with either vertical or inverted U flap incisions.
- Animals were cannulated for 14 days and observed for three months.
- Endolaryngeal photography, gross specimen examination, and histological analysis were performed.
Main Results:
- Flap tracheostomies resulted in less tracheal lumen distortion compared to vertical incisions.
- Animals with flap tracheostomies maintained stomal lumen area, unlike vertical incisions which showed an 18% average area loss.
- Histological examination revealed cartilaginous growth across flap tracheostomy sites, but not vertical sites.
Conclusions:
- Flap tracheostomy techniques are superior to vertical incisions for preserving tracheal lumen integrity.
- The flap technique promotes beneficial cartilaginous regrowth at the tracheostomy site.
- Animal experimentation supports the use of flap tracheostomy for improved surgical outcomes.
